"After speaking to GMs and scouts at this week's Combine, USA Today's Tom Pelissero emerged believing Oklahoma RB Joe Mixon will be drafted in the second or third round.

Arguably the most talented all-purpose back in the draft, Mixon's stock is a topic of debate because he was videotaped hitting a girl in the mouth in 2014, costing Mixon that entire season at Oklahoma in addition to lawsuits and legal charges. Pelissero acknowledged "it's clear" Mixon won't be on some teams' draft boards, but says "some scouts" have Mixon rated as a top 15-20 player in the draft. Pelissero says scouts viewed Mixon as the "heartbeat of the Sooners' team," and "the word out of OU on Mixon('s character) is positive overall."

Florida State RB Dalvin Cook tested as ninth-percentile SPARQ athlete at the NFL Combine.
Tennessee RB Alvin Kamara had the highest SPARQ score of any back in Indy, hitting the 79th percentile. Cook was at the opposite end of the spectrum, struggling in the three-cone drill (7.27), 20-yard shuttle (4.53), vertical (30.5"), and broad jump (9'8"). He did run a solid forty (4.49). Still, it was a concerning weekend for a back considered a potential first-round pick. According to 3 Sigma Athlete's Zach Whitman, no running back who tested as a sub-10th-percentile SPARQ athlete has been drafted in the first round in the last 17 years. Mar 4 - 8:23 PM

MMQB's Albert Breer mentions Florida State RB Dalvin Cook's "off-field questions" as a reason he may not pass LSU's Leonard Fournette to be this year's first running back drafted.
Breer didn't elaborate, but it's not the first time "off-field issues" have been mentioned regarding Cook. Cook was suspended for allegedly punching a woman outside a Tallahassee bar in 2015 -- it wasn't caught on video like Joe Mixon -- and Cook was also cited in 2014 for leaving three pitbull puppies chained up by their necks in an unsheltered area, resulting in a $550 fine. Cook apparently had two more non-detailed run-ins with police at Florida State. Feb 23 - 11:12 AM

ESPN's Jamison Hensley wrote "no one should be surprised" if the Ravens select a running back in the first round this year.
Baltimore has not selected a running back in the first round since Jamal Lewis in 2000, but coach John Harbaugh has consistently talked about the Ravens' need to improve the running game and sounded open to the idea of a first-round runner at the Combine. "They’ve done pretty well," Harbaugh said. "Ezekiel Elliott is a pretty good example of that. He’s an example of a guy we were very interested in when we were picking so high last year. I think any great player, any playmaker, is worth a first-round pick." Of course, Day 2 and Day 3 running backs have also "done pretty well," and it is unclear if the Ravens view Leonard Fournette or Dalvin Cook as a "great player." For what it is worth, Fournette has drawn some comparisons to Lewis. Mar 4 - 8:58 AM

LSU RB Leonard Fournette's official forty time at the Combine was 4.51.
His "unofficial" times were 4.51 and 4.52. According to Fantasy Guru's Graham Barfield, Fournette has 94th-percentile weight-adjusted speed at 6-foot, 240 pounds, and Fournette's Speed Score is the second best among 235-plus-pound running backs in the last decade. Fournette is a bit awkward in the passing game and lacks standout lateral movement ability, but his combination of size and straight-line speed is freakish. Earlier in the day, Fournette disappointed with a 28.5-inch vertical, which is offensive-line territory. He turned down the opportunity to do a broad jump and will hopefully do one at LSU's Pro Day. Hey Foot, here's the top 9 fastest times from the combine (prior to 2017) for WR/RB:

4.24 Rondel Menendez WR
4.24 Chris Johnson RB
4.26 Jerome Mathis WR
4.26 Dri Archer RB
4.27 Marquise Goodwin WR
4.28 Jacoby Ford WR
4.28 J. J. Nelson WR
4.30 Yamon Figurs WR
4.30 Darrius Heyward-Bey WR

Unofficial analysis: Speed does not make a career.

I think there is a lot of over reaction to the running back numbers

Cook is still a good receiver that can cut with good vision, but has some injury concers and ball control concerns
Fournette is still strong and fast with bricks for hands and no ability to create
McCaffrey still isn't a guy i would want to see running between the tackles all that often, but will be great in the other parts of the game

Film matters a lot more than underwear Olympics Mixon didn't even get to go and his stock seems to be on the rise
